Winter Fashion 2009
What's in for fashion right now: scarves are sooo in right now. There is a scarf out there for just about every outfit. Plain scarfs, long scarfs, designed scarfs, and crazy scarfs..there is one for you! My favorite is my red and black plaid print. It looks stunner on top of a plain black shirt. Also, one shouldered tops and dresses are very hot. This is my personal favorite. Unfortunately, this look is not for everyone, especially those with broad shoulders. This symmetrical design is eye catching and a classy revealing look. I tried on the prettiest long sleeved one shouldered top today but unfortunately the color did not go well with my pale white skin. But I'm sure I'll find another one out there in this crazy shopping world. And new this season making a huge entrance...SEQUINS! Sequins are very popular and help just about anything it is on to stand out. When the light hits it, it's sure to turn heads. Sequins are found on everything from clothes to hats and even purses and shoes. They come in just about every color so that is never an issue. Kanye West...why?
The Kanye West/Lady Gaga tour was coming up in December. I heard about this concert back in July and I knew I HAD to go. After talking to my parents, they gave me the OK and told me to go ahead and look at ticket prices. I also told some friends who I knew would be interested in going if they wanted to tag along. I had seen Kanye West live on my TV and his performance was incredible! I could not wait until December came around. Two days ago, my dad yelled, "Lauren, turn on the news!" I could not believe what I was hearing...the whole tour was canceled! "WHY?", I asked myself. Well about a month ago on the VMA's, Kanye had to give his opinion on how he felt about Taylor Swift winning an award over Beyonce. He was continually boo-ed throughout the evening and comments were being made about him all around the world that night. Although I lost alot of respect for him after he stole Taylor's spotlight, I couldn't hate him forever and it did not erase the fact that he is an amazing artist. This incident had alot to do with the cancellation of the tour. His manager felt that many people would not attend the show due to his mishap and they were not prepared to spend money on something that would not sell. Also Lady Gaga, made the statement that her and Kanye had artistic differences while planning the show so she decided to still continue on her own solo tour. Although I am highly upset that the tour is no more, I believe Kanye learned that you reap what you sow.
